Question
Particle in a box (2D)
Determine the energy levels (degeneracy) of the lowest three
I found that E = A (4a^2 + b^2)
where A is a constant
a and b are positive integers (principle quantum number)
My steps
I assume 4a^2 + b^2 = k
where k is also a positive integer
The minimum value of a and b are 1, so k ≥ 5
I would like to find the combination of a and b for a given k.
But I don't know how to solve integral solution.
Is there any systematic methods apart from trial and error ?
